My Approach
My approach to therapy is primarily psychodynamic and relational, meaning we explore how past experiences shape the ways we think, feel, and connect with others today.
At the same time, I draw from:
-
Internal Family Systems (IFS)
-
Cognitive behavioral techniques
-
Dialectical behavioral techniques
-
Mindfulness practices
-
Existential perspectives
Together we identify patterns, emotional triggers, and relational dynamics while building the tools and insight needed to move forward with greater clarity.
